    The Wags and Menace Make a Difference Foundation is a not-for-profit 501 (c)(3) organization that seeks to provide medical treatment for sick animals in Colorado, the United States, and global funding to organizations and activities that benefit animals, and to inspire, teach, and motivate other individuals and organizations to achieve similar objectives.
